从文本到声音:语音合成API的无限应用与开发实践
2025.10.12 16:34浏览量:0简介:本文深入探讨语音合成API的技术原理、应用场景及开发实践,揭示其如何将文本转化为自然流畅的声音,并解锁跨领域创新应用的无限可能。
从文本到声音:语音合成API的无限应用与开发实践
一、引言:文本到声音的技术革命
在人工智能技术快速发展的今天,语音合成API已成为连接数字世界与人类感知的关键桥梁。通过将文本转化为自然流畅的声音,这项技术不仅重塑了人机交互的方式,更在教育、娱乐、无障碍服务等领域催生了颠覆性创新。本文将系统解析语音合成API的核心原理、技术演进及典型应用场景,并结合实际开发案例,为开发者提供从入门到进阶的完整指南。
二、语音合成API的技术架构解析
1. 核心技术原理
语音合成(Text-to-Speech, TTS)的核心在于将文本序列转化为声学信号,其流程可分为三个阶段:
- 文本分析:通过自然语言处理(NLP)技术对输入文本进行分词、词性标注、韵律预测等处理,生成包含停顿、重音等信息的标注序列。
- 声学建模:基于深度学习模型(如Tacotron、FastSpeech等)将文本特征映射为声学特征(如梅尔频谱),这一过程需解决长文本依赖、多音字消歧等挑战。
- 声码器转换:将声学特征通过WaveNet、HiFi-GAN等声码器转换为原始音频波形,关键指标包括自然度(MOS评分)、实时率(RTF)等。
技术演进:从早期基于规则的拼接合成,到统计参数合成(HMM-TTS),再到当前主流的端到端神经网络合成,语音合成的自然度已接近人类水平。例如,某开源TTS模型在LJSpeech数据集上的MOS评分可达4.5分(5分制)。
2. API设计关键要素
优质的语音合成API需满足以下设计原则:
- 低延迟:支持流式合成,首包响应时间<500ms。
- 多语言支持:覆盖主流语种及方言,如中文需支持普通话、粤语等。
- 音色定制:提供预训练音色库,并支持通过少量数据微调自定义音色。
- 情感控制:通过参数调节实现高兴、悲伤、愤怒等情绪表达。
三、跨领域应用场景全景图
1. 教育领域:个性化学习伴侣
- 智能助教:将教材文本转化为多音色音频,支持倍速播放、重点段落循环等功能。
- 语言学习:通过API生成带发音标注的口语练习材料,结合ASR技术实现实时纠错。
- 无障碍阅读:为视障学生提供实时文本转语音服务,支持PDF、EPUB等多格式解析。
案例:某在线教育平台接入TTS API后,用户完课率提升27%,其中视障用户占比达15%。
2. 娱乐产业:沉浸式内容创作
- 有声书制作:将小说文本批量转化为专业级有声内容,成本较人工录制降低80%。
- 游戏NPC对话:通过动态文本生成实现NPC语音的实时交互,增强游戏沉浸感。
- 虚拟偶像:结合3D建模与TTS技术,打造可定制音色的虚拟主播。
3. 商业服务:智能化客户体验
- IVR系统:将传统按键菜单升级为自然语音导航,客户满意度提升35%。
- 电商导购:通过语音合成生成商品介绍音频,支持多语言跨境服务。
- 智能客服:结合NLP与TTS技术,实现7×24小时自动应答,解决率达82%。
四、开发实践:从API调用到系统集成
1. 快速入门指南
以某云平台TTS API为例,基础调用流程如下:
import requests
def text_to_speech(text, voice_type="female"):
url = "https://api.example.com/tts"
headers = {"Authorization": "Bearer YOUR_API_KEY"}
data = {
"text": text,
"voice": voice_type,
"format": "mp3",
"speed": 1.0
}
response = requests.post(url, headers=headers, json=data)
with open("output.mp3", "wb") as f:
f.write(response.content)
return "output.mp3"
关键参数说明:
voice_type
:支持”male”、”female”、”child”等预设音色speed
:范围0.5-2.0,控制语速emotion
:可选”happy”、”sad”、”neutral”等情绪标签
2. 高级优化技巧
- 缓存机制:对高频文本建立音频缓存,减少API调用次数。
- 动态调整:根据上下文自动选择合适音色(如新闻类文本使用庄重男声)。
- 多线程处理:对长文本进行分段合成,并行处理提升效率。
性能优化案例:某物流公司通过引入缓存机制,使TTS调用成本降低60%,响应时间缩短至300ms以内。
五、挑战与未来展望
1. 当前技术瓶颈
- 情感表达:现有模型对复杂情感的渲染仍显生硬。
- 小样本学习:定制音色需大量标注数据,成本较高。
- 实时交互:在低算力设备上的实时合成仍存在延迟。
2. 发展趋势
- 多模态融合:结合唇形同步、手势生成等技术,打造全息数字人。
- 个性化适配:通过用户历史数据自动优化合成参数。
- 边缘计算:将轻量级模型部署至终端设备,实现离线合成。
六、结语:开启声音创新的新纪元
语音合成API正从单一工具进化为跨领域创新的基础设施。对于开发者而言,掌握这项技术不仅意味着能够快速构建语音应用,更将获得参与定义下一代人机交互范式的机会。随着情感计算、小样本学习等技术的突破,我们有理由相信,未来的语音合成将超越”模拟人类”的阶段,创造出前所未有的声音体验。
行动建议:
- 从开源TTS模型(如Mozilla TTS)入手,理解基础原理
- 优先接入支持多语言、情感控制的商业API进行快速验证
- 关注学术前沿(如VITS、Diffusion-TTS等新模型)
- 结合具体业务场景设计MVP(最小可行产品)进行迭代
在声音即服务的时代,每一次文本到声音的转换,都是一次创造价值的契机。让我们共同探索这片充满可能的蓝海!
发表评论
登录后可评论,请前往 登录 或 注册